Description (What the record is about)
-
John Clevland. George Vaughan acted as Surgeon of the Devonshire by order of Vice Admiral Holburne. Opine he should be paid an allownace by bill equal to the pay of Surgeon for the time he acted as Surgeon because he was Surgeon of the Ferret until he had directions to replace Mr Sherwin of the Devonshire who was out of his senses and who is on her books
